The Museum of Military History in Kissimmee, Florida, is a dedicated institution focusing on preserving and showcasing military heritage through its extensive collection of artifacts, exhibits, and educational displays. As one of the prominent museums in the region, it offers visitors an opportunity to explore various aspects of military history, from significant battles to the evolution of military technology. Located in the heart of Kissimmee, the museum serves as a cultural and historical resource for both residents and tourists interested in the armed forces’ legacy.
Inside the museum, visitors can experience carefully curated exhibits that highlight different branches of the military and their roles in shaping national and global events. The displays include uniforms, weapons, vehicles, and personal memorabilia that provide a tangible connection to the past. The museum also emphasizes the stories of individual service members, adding a personal dimension to the historical narrative. Educational programs and guided tours enhance the experience, making it accessible to a wide range of audiences, including students, historians, and military enthusiasts.
